Endoscopic Management of Vesicoureteral Reflux and Long-term Follow-up. 2018

OBJECTIVE To report our experience with endoscopic management of vesicoureteral reflux (VUR) by injection of a tissue bulking substance - Dextranomer/ hyaluronic acid co-polymer at vesicoureteric junction. METHODS Retrospective analyses of case records. METHODS Pediatric Surgery department in a tertiary care government Institute. METHODS 500 children (767 renal units) consecutively referred to the out-patient department with vesicoureteral reflux noted on micturating cysto-urethrogram (MCU) over a period of 13 years (2004-2016). METHODS Preoperative VUR grading and renal scars on radionuclide scans were documented. Dextranomer hyaluronic acid copolymer was injected through a cystoscope at the vesicoureteral junction as a day care procedure under short anesthesia. Patients were followed (average duration 27.3 mo) with clinical assessment, periodic urine cultures and renal scans. METHODS Cessation of VUR and symptomatic relief / clinical success postoperatively at 3 months. RESULTS Complete symptomatic relief was obtained in 482 (96.4%) patients. In 681 units where MCU was available, 614 (90%) units showed resolution of VUR. CONCLUSIONS Endoscopic injection of tissue bulking substances at vesicoureteric junction to stop VUR seems to be an effective intervention.

D003911 Dextrans A group of glucose polymers made by certain bacteria. Dextrans are used therapeutically as plasma volume expanders and anticoagulants. They are also commonly used in biological experimentation and in industry for a wide variety of purposes. D004724 Endoscopy Procedures of applying ENDOSCOPES for disease diagnosis and treatment. Endoscopy involves passing an optical instrument through a small incision in the skin i.e., percutaneous; or through a natural orifice and along natural body pathways such as the digestive tract; and/or through an incision in the wall of a tubular structure or organ, i.e. transluminal, to examine or perform surgery on the interior parts of the body.
